2.
Coverage Period:
Generally, depending on the state, SDI benefits pay for a portion of income up to four weeks before the scheduled delivery date and up to six or eight weeks following birth. Should difficulties emerge during pregnancy or labor, this period may be prolonged.
3.
Medical Certification:
An expecting mother needs a medical professional's certification that her pregnancy-related ailments prevent her from working in order to be eligible for SDI benefits during her pregnancy. This certification is essential for determining eligibility and guaranteeing prompt benefit payments.
4.
Application Process:
To apply for SDI benefits, one must submit a claim to the state's Employment Development Department (EDD) or a comparable agency together with the necessary medical evidence. It is advisable to start the application procedure as soon as possible to prevent delays in benefits receipt.
5.
Benefit Calculation:
Up to a state-set maximum, SDI payments vary according to a person's past wage history. A clear understanding of how benefits are computed makes estimating the financial support available throughout the maternity leave period easier.
